Transaction dffd69173c6c04b5a76334a496ad44089a5e413ce0666ac447046ca34d333458
1 Input
-
857932e707a9610c37050222eca3f438563c6fc6ce184b8eca7157ad6dd9c453:27
OP_DATA_48(48) 43021f6d5a29c6b98447d92013baa56abc4b39fd6b7a34b7aad374bcaba54902dbcc02204859affd7b1e7512dcd2fb3b
1 Outputs
- dffd69173c6c04b5a76334a496ad44089a5e413ce0666ac447046ca34d333458:0
value 10994160
address 33EAfvKZHp2n9vsNYiwmHnAppaQVkADjMj